Jaguars narrow general manager search to five finalists (WJXT)
JACKSONVILLE, Fla. – The Jaguars have chosen their top five finalists for the vacant general manager position, cutting the list from 11 candidates who the team interviewed virtually over the past week.
Ian Cunningham, the Bears assistant general manager
James Gladstone,the Rams director of scouting strategy.
Jon-Eric Sullivan, the Packers vice president of player personnel.
Josh Williams, the 49ers director/scouting and football operations.
Starting Wednesday, the five finalists will be interviewed in person.
None of the Jags top five candidates has served as a general manager before, so whoever does get the job of making the team’s decisions will be doing it all for the first time.
